[gtk/macos-ci: 7/7] Pass coretext=enabled to harfbuzz
- From: Matthias Clasen <matthiasc src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tk/macos-ci: 7/7] Pass coretext=enabled to harfbuzz
- Date: Mon, 4 Jan 2021 02:27:00 +0000 (UTC)
commit 3d61d78094d072596b711443ba7ded40ca40aafa
Author: Matthias Clasen <mclasen redhat com>
Date: Sun Jan 3 21:11:56 2021 -0500
Pass coretext=enabled to harfbuzz
When we use harfbuzz as a subproject on OS X,
we (or rather, pango) need coretext support.
meson.build |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
---
diff --git a/meson.build b/meson.build
index c84653c263..8987a5d8fb 100644
--- a/meson.build
+++ b/meson.build
@@ -380,7 +380,8 @@ pixbuf_dep = dependency('gdk-pixbuf-2.0', version: gdk_pixbuf_req,
epoxy_dep = dependency('epoxy', version: epoxy_req,
fallback: ['libepoxy', 'libepoxy_dep'])
harfbuzz_dep = dependency('harfbuzz', version: '>= 0.9', required: false,
- fallback: ['harfbuzz', 'libharfbuzz_dep'])
+ fallback: ['harfbuzz', 'libharfbuzz_dep'],
+ default_options: ['coretext=enabled'])
xkbdep = dependency('xkbcommon', version: xkbcommon_req, required: wayland_enabled)
if os_darwin
graphene_dep = dependency('graphene-gobject-1.0', version: graphene_req,
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]